Java Sort Map By Key
Please explain in details. How to sort a mapkey value on the values in java.
How To Delete A Key Value Pair From A Hashmap During Iteration In
In this example we are sorting the hashmap based on the keys using the treemap collection class.
Java sort map by key. How to sort a hash map using key descending order. If there is a need we need to sort it explicitly based on the requirement. Hashmap is not meant to keep entries in sorted order but if you have to sort hashmap based upon keys or values you can do that in java.
In this tutorial we will learn how to sort hashmap by keys using treemap and by values using comparator. I am using map interface to read from a file and then store the values in that as a key value pair. Thats all about how to sort a map by keys in java 8.
Please explain with example. Using treemap putall method the idea is to put all data of hashmap into a treemapthe treemap follows red black tree based implementation. And how many way to sort a hash map.
Sorting the mapkeyvalue in descending order based on the value duplicate. Sorting hashmap on keys is quite easy all you need to do is to create a treemap by copying entries from hashmap. This can be used to sort the map in reverse order.
Linkedhashmap or a sorted map eg. Alternatively you can pass a custom comparator to use in sorting. Hashmap is a class in java that implements map interface and holds values based on an unique keyas we know hashmap is an unsorted and unordered map.
In java 8 mapentry class has static method comparingbykey to help you in sorting by keys. A 34 b 25 c 50. This method returns a comparator that compares mapentry in natural order on key.
Hence requirements come where we need to sort the hashmap either by its key or valuesin this post we will take a look into how to sort a hashmap by key as well as by value. The map is sorted according to the natural ordering of its keys. Hashmap sorting by keys.
The simplest way to achieve this is by using the sorted method of stream and the newly added comparingkey method of mapentry class. The stream sorts all elements and then depending upon your need you can either print entries in sorted order or stored them in an ordered map eg. 11 uses javautiltreemap it will sort the map by keys automatically.
The file format is as follows.
Java Collections Framework Video Tutorial
Java 8 Convert Map To List Using Collectors Tolist Example
Java Hashmap Constructors Methods Of Hashmap In Java Dataflair
Java 8 Declarative Ways Of Modifying A Map Using Compute Merge And
Msjavasolutions Ms Java Solutions
Free Java Tutorials Collections And Generics Maps Java 5
Powenko Android Tutorial 009 2 Array Hashmap Powenko 柯博文
Free Java Tutorials Collections And Generics Maps Java 5
Internal Working Of Treemap In Java Dinesh On Java
Es6 Collections Using Map Set Weakmap Weakset Sitepoint
Java Hashmap Tutorial With Examples Callicoder
Java Map Hashmap Treemap のkey Valueでソートする方法 侍
Java Sort Map By Values Ascending And Descending Orders
Java Collections Framework Video Tutorial
Java Map Collection Tutorial And Examples
Java Coding Interview Question Object As Key And Sort In Hashmap
Difference Between Hashmap And Hashsetv Geeksforgeeks
Java Sortedmap Sorted Map In Java Journaldev
Sorted Map Example By Value Or By Key Or By Comparator
Java Hashmap Containskey Object Key And Containsvalue Object
Java Concurrentnavigablemap And Concurrentskiplistmap Tutorial With
Sort Java Util Map By Value Or Key Codermagnet Java Jcr Aem
0 Response to "Java Sort Map By Key"
Post a Comment